16 Pieces Hydraulic Tappets 420011810 for C20XE X18XE X14XE Components Easy Install High Performance

16 Pieces Hydraulic Tappets 420011810 for C20XE X18XE X14XE Components Easy Install High Performance
thumb
thumb
thumb
thumb
thumb
thumb
sku: 1005003091335245
$36.18
Shipping from: China
   Price history chart & currency exchange rate

Customers also viewed